Effects of Carbon Release
Carbon emissions have a profound effect on our planet, playing a crucial role to the global warming crisis. As greenhouse gases are discharged into the atmosphere, they retain heat and result in rising global heat levels. This increase in temperature alters weather patterns, leading to more extreme events such as tropical storms, droughts, and floods. These changes threaten natural habitats and biodiversity, risking the existence of countless species.
In addition to environmental changes, carbon emissions also have significant consequences for human health. Increased air contamination associated with high carbon output leads to respiratory problems, cardiovascular diseases, and other health issues. Vulnerable populations, including youths and the elderly, are particularly at risk. The burden on healthcare systems increases as the health effects of contaminants become more pronounced, straining resources and impacting economies.
Additionally, the financial consequences of carbon emissions are significant and far-reaching. The financial burdens associated with climate-related disasters are rising, placing an immense financial burden on governments and societies. Industries that rely extensively on fossil fuels face increasing regulation and potential decline as the world moves toward sustainable practices. Transitioning to a sustainable future presents both challenges and opportunities, as economies are urged to advance and change in response to the escalating impacts of global warming.
Ways to Sustainable Development
Shifting to a eco-friendly future requires a comprehensive approach that focuses on abatement of carbon emissions. One key pathway is the improvement of sustainable energy sources like photovoltaic, aero, and hydroelectric power. By backing these technologies and advancing energy storage solutions, societies can significantly decrease dependency on fossil fuels. This change not only diminishes carbon emissions but also helps broaden energy portfolios, making them more resilient to market fluctuations. Communities that adopt renewable energy can also create jobs while promoting energy independence.
Another significant aspect involves revamping transportation systems to favor electric and public transit solutions. Electrifying current vehicle fleets, supporting walking and cycling, and expanding public transport networks can notably cut emissions from one of the major contributing sectors. These changes can also enhance urban living by diminishing air pollution and boosting overall public health. Finally, encouraging sustainable agricultural practices and reforestation efforts is crucial in addressing the climate crisis. Implementing regenerative farming techniques can lead to healthier soils, increased biodiversity, and lowered carbon footprints while simultaneously enhancing food security. Protecting and restoring forests plays a pivotal role as well, as trees absorb significant amounts of carbon dioxide from the atmosphere. By aligning economic incentives with environmental goals, societies can develop a sustainable partnership with nature that provides a balanced ecosystem for future generations.
